Congrats to BREATHE member, Russ Hepple, for being awarded a UF College of Public Health & Health Professions Research Innovation Fund! The grant will allow him to test his hypothesis that mitochondrial permeability transition (mPT) contributes to #skeletalmuscle changes. Read more at: bit.ly/3RanPFW👏
